Urinary tract stones, known as urinary lithiasis or kidney stones, are hard deposits of minerals and salts that form in the kidneys or urinary tract.
Frequent symptoms: Intense pain in the lower back or side that may radiate toward the groin, blood in the urine, burning when urinating, and a frequent need to do so.
Common causes: Low fluid intake, certain eating habits, and metabolic factors favor their formation.
Which specialist treats them? The urologist is the reference for studying and following up on these cases. If you experience sudden, strong pain in your side or notice blood in your urine, seeking medical evaluation is the prudent course.
